A convicted rapist who absconded from a South Gloucestershire prison on Friday has been arrested.

Daniel Thompson, 34, failed to report for roll call at 4.45pm on Friday at Leyhill Prison.

Thompson had last been seen at 11.45am at the facility, where he was being held for breaching a court order after serving a 10-year sentence for rape.

Avon and Somerset Police have now confirmed that Thompson has been arrested and remains in police custody.
